Job Summary

The Senior Estimator operates with minimal oversight on preconstruction teams, frequently serving as the principal point of contact with the design team and the owner. Senior estimators are capable of leading all types of project delivery methods and have demonstrated competence in basic and advanced estimating functions. Desired estimating disciplines include earthwork, paving, underground utilities, and structures on transit, civil infrastructure, and highway projects. Successful candidates will prepare detailed take-offs, solicit quotes, develop cost estimates, and close out bids.

Key Responsibilities

  • Advanced level HCSS knowledge of estimate entry and quote system tools.
  • Estimate all scopes related to their discipline area of expertise.
  • Perform detailed quantity take-offs on bid items and materials in order to develop all-inclusive cost estimates.
  • Estimate unit costs by analyzing crew composition, production rates, and equipment selection.
  • Participate in detailed reviews, providing thorough explanation of estimate.
  • Utilization of relevant cost history database to verify production rates.
  • Prepare supplier bid packages to ensure that self-performed work has competitive material quotes.
  • Coordinate junior estimators and interns with takeoff and vendor solicitation processes.
  • Assist in obtaining firm quotes for material suppliers, equipment, and subcontractors.
